Rhubarbarian is a melee plant in Plants vs. Zombies 2 introduced in the 9.7.1 update for the Rhubarbarian's Savage Arena season. When planted, Rhubarbarian falls from the sky and causes an earthquake, damaging and stunning zombies in a 3x3 area. Then it attacks nearby zombies, dealing heavy damage, stunning the zombies and even punching them off the lawn entirely. When Rhubarbarian runs out of things to attack, it somersaults forward to attack further targets, with a detection range of 4.5 tiles.
The following zombies cannot be flicked off the lawn but can be damaged: Imp Cannon, Dr. Zomboss, Cardio Zombie, Roman Caesar Zombie, Z-Mech, #caketank, Gargantuar variants, Treasure Yeti, Zcorpion Zombie, Zombie King, Zombie Medusa, Fisherman Zombie, Catapult Zombie, Zomboni, and Zombie Bobsled Team.
In Plants Vs Zombies 2 China Rhubarbarian functions similar expect now is more akin to a actual melee plant no longer disappearing, it will return to its spot after it does a jump and now can actually be killed
Origins[]

Rhubarbarian is based on the rhubarb (Rhenum hybridum), a plant with fleshy edible stalks in the knotweed family Polygonaceae. It is a pun between "rhubarb" and "barbarian" used to denote a person in ancient times a member of a community or tribe not belonging to one of the great civilizations or an uncultured or brutish person.

Plant Food Effect (China Only)[]
When Given Plant Food Rhubarbarin will slam the ground 3 times moving forward on the lawn if there are zombies in his tile range once he does all his slams he will Return to his normal position
Enforce-mint effect[]
When boosted by Enforce-mint, Rhubarbarian will deal an additional 560 damage with its initial attacks, and an additional 200 damage with its punch attacks.

Strategies[]
Rhubarbarian is a time-effective melee plant. Although it is a melee plant, it is more flexible, in other words, it has more output opportunities than other melee plants because of its ability to roll forward. Its attack is very powerful, stunning zombies and even punching them off the lawn (killing them instantly). This means that zombies with high health can be easily solved. At the same time, as its punching attack ignores the zombies' level, it performs very well in the more difficult levels of Penny's Pursuit. Even if a zombie, such as a Gargantuar, is unable to be killed instantly, it can be extremely damaged. Rhubarbarian can deal a total of 1790 damage (including the damage caused by its planting) within a 16-second survival time. This damage will be increased to 51360 after being upgraded and strengthened by Enforce-mint. One of the weaknesses of Rhubarbarian is its slow recharge time. You can try to use an imitater, or Plant Food to drag it to the slot to immediately cooldown Rhubarbarian.
Rhubarbarian is not suitable for some levels, such as Big Wave Beach or Pirate Seas, because it cannot jump into the water, which limits its attack ability. Meanwhile, it cannot jump to the grid occupied by plants or obstacles. Because of its great damage, it is also a good hand at clearing obstacles. Rhubarbarian can also be combined with Escape Root and Sweet Potato/Garlic/Hot Date. Escape Root can bring Rhubarbarian to other rows to solve the zombie crisis of multiple rows, while Sweet Potato/Garlic/Hot Date can gather zombies in the same row to facilitate the increase of the number of zombies that Rhubarbarian can solve at one time. As a instant-use plant, Rhubarbarian cannot be dug up. It is invincible when leaping or attacking zombies, and is immune to any form of damage this moment. Rhubarbarian can slightly prolong its lifespan (or temporarily stop the loss of its lifespan) every time it tosses zombies off.
In general, Rhubarbarian has rich functions and novel mechanisms. In many cases, it is an excellent plant. It can even be compared to a Lawn Mower.

Trivia[]
- Rhubarbarian has the same stun effect (a halo that surrounds the zombie's head) as Blockoli's.
- Rhubarbarian has the same spinning animation as Tumbleweed.
- When he appears on the lawn, an electrical guitar riff can be heard.
- Despite not having a Plant Food ability, it has an animation for being watered in the Zen Garden. The animation can be seen when it is ready to level up.
- It, Puffball, Ice Bloom, Heath Seeker, Teleportato Mine, Chilly Pepper, Cran Jelly, and Bud'uh Boom are the only instant use plants released after Far Future to have this distinction.
- Rhubarbarian is the first and currently only instant use plant in the enforce-mint family
